With this bread maker, you can control the ingredients and nutritional content. Substitute milk for water. Throw in some herbs. Add nuts or raisins. The sky’s the limit. There are 12 pre-programmed cycles, allowing you to make everything from healthy whole grain and gluten-free loaves to dough for sweet, gooey cinnamon buns or homemade pizza. There are also options for 1.5 or 2-pound loaf sizes and three crust settings for light, medium, or dark. Just toss in your ingredients, select your cycle and settings, and hit start.

Want to wake up to the smell of fresh-baked bread(opens in a new tab)? Use the delay start setting to set a schedule in advance. It’ll even keep your loaf warm for an hour after cooking, for the days you get to sleep in.
